What Travellers Say
Reviews Summary
Visitors consistently praise the intimate and immersive experience at The Other Place theatre, highlighting its unique in-the-round staging. The charm of Stratford-upon-Avon, its historical significance, and the quality of RSC productions are frequently lauded. However, some find the town can feel small or overly focused on Shakespeare, and card-only payment policies can be an inconvenience.
"This is the RSC'S third theatre space. Currently being used to show a youth version of Timon of Athens. Very good, enthusiastic performance in a pleasant smaller venue. Cafe is nice but beware, card only."

"Splendid theatre in the round with every seat within 3 rows of the stage. This gives an up-close and intimate atmosphere. Arguably the best way to experience the plays"

🎫 🎭 Onsite Experience
The Other Place is a smaller, intimate theatre space within the RSC complex, featuring an in-the-round stage. This setup provides a very close and immersive experience for the audience.
Key sites include Shakespeare's Birthplace, Hall's Croft, Anne Hathaway's Cottage, and Mary Arden's Farm. The Royal Shakespeare Theatre and The Other Place are also essential for theatre lovers.
